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
972370423 23411584425 90771 45467171113 070203491
634 932484437
634 932484437
9976 09 7821786
All about undefined
Interested in learning more?
634 932484437
9976 09 7821786
See more
5128709834 9559 1952928
710876846 66106 05
See more
62286435038 1601
208040 37 8944
See more